The anime adaptation of Tales of Wedding Rings has received a teaser visual featuring main heroine Hime and a trailer previewing its main cast and premise. The show will premiere in 2024.
Takashi Naoya (Vermeil in Gold) is directing with Deko Akao (My Stepmom’s Daughter Is My Ex) as series composer and Saori Nakashiki (The Great Jahy Will Not Be Defeated!) as character designer. Staple Entertainment is the animation production company.
Meanwhile, additional main cast members were announced in the form of Miyuri Shimabukuro as Nephrites, Hitomi Ueda as Granart, Ai Kakuma as Saphir, and Mikako Komatsu as Amber. The previously announced cast includes Gen Sato as Sato and Akari Kitou as Hime.
Maybe‘s Square Enix-published Tales of Wedding Rings manga began in 2014 and has 13 tankoubon volumes as of January 2023. It is serialized in Monthly Big Gangan and published under the Big Gangan Comics label. Crunchyroll describes the series as:
